Share via


CalculationGroupExpression 类

定义

表格 CalculationGroupExpression 对象。 当无法应用计算项时,在此对象上定义的表达式将应用于 DAX 查询中的选定度量值。

public sealed class CalculationGroupExpression : Microsoft.AnalysisServices.Tabular.MetadataObject
type CalculationGroupExpression = class
    inherit MetadataObject
Public NotInheritable Class CalculationGroupExpression
Inherits MetadataObject
继承
CalculationGroupExpression

注解

仅当数据库的兼容级别为 1605 或更高时,才支持此元数据对象。

构造函数

CalculationGroupExpression()

使用默认设置创建 CalculationGroupExpression 类的新实例。

属性

CalculationGroup

对拥有 CalculationGroupExpression 的 CalculationGroup 对象的引用。

Description

CalculationGroupExpression 的说明,在设计时对开发人员和管理工具(如SQL Server Management Studio)的管理员可见。

ErrorMessage

解释与 CalculationGroupExpression 关联的错误状态的字符串。 仅当表达式的状态是 SemanticError、DependencyError 或 SyntaxError 这三个值之一时由引擎设置。

Expression

为 CalculationGroupExpression 计算的 DAX 表达式。

FormatStringDefinition

对 CalculationGroupExpression 拥有的 FormatStringDefinition 对象的引用。

IsRemoved

一个布尔值,该值指定此对象是否已从对象树中移除。

(继承自 MetadataObject)
Model

获取包含此对象的表格模型。

(继承自 MetadataObject)
ModifiedTime

上次修改对象的时间。

ObjectType

获取对象的类型。

Parent

父对象,对于 Model 对象为 NULL。

State

提供有关表达式状态的信息。 可能的值及其解释如下所示。 Ready (1) 表达式可查询,且有最新数据。 SemanticError (5) 表达式具有语义错误。 DependencyError (7) 与 Expression 关联的依赖项处于错误状态 (SemanticError、EvaluationError 或 DependencyError) 。 SyntaxError (9) 表达式具有语法错误。

方法

Clone()

创建 CalculationGroupExpression 对象的完整副本。

CopyFrom(CalculationGroupExpression)
已过时.

已弃用。 请改用 CopyTo 方法。

CopyTo(CalculationGroupExpression)

将 CalculationGroupExpression 对象复制到指定的 对象。

Validate()

此 API 支持产品基础结构,不能在代码中直接使用。 仅限 Microsoft 内部使用。

(继承自 MetadataObject)

适用于